Apart from all these gifts there are so many other things you can get or make yourself, in the end it is the thought that matters so anything you find is worth so so much.

Examples of home-made things:

For your family – Make a little photo book with your favourite photos together. Since we never really print our photos anymore like the old days, we don’t keep photo albums anymore. I think it is so sad because I love to look through old photos from the past but since 10 years there are none. So making a little photo album which you can personalise with stickers, text etc etc, is something I’m sure they will love and something they will look at again in 10 years and really appreciate.

For your friend – Design your own cups. I found this on pinterest the other day and loved it, see the blogpost tutorial here. You just need some simple cups that you can get cheap in IKEA, nail polish and water and you can create beautiful and unique cups. I haven’t tried it yet, but have already decided to do it with my sister these cozy Christmas days.

For your boyfriend – Get him an experience. It can be a little trip to another city, a night in a hotel to get away from normal day life, a blind dinner (when you eat in complete darkness) or why not paintball?
